temper-skills

Give an agent skill's decision logic a test suite and a deterministic implementation — a labeled validation dataset plus versionable Python — by driving the installed temper-skills CLI (never reimplementing the logic in prose). Use in agents without a native subagent primitive (Cursor, Hermes, generic tools) when the user wants to test, eval, audit, temper, freeze, or harden the routing/decision logic of a prompt, skill.md, or playbook ("test my skill", "what is this skill deciding?"), including auditing a whole skills directory; requires `pip install temper-skills` and a model backend (a logged-in claude/opencode CLI or an API key). Not for continuous scoring, text generation, or logic with no documentation the model can reach.
